Ardent Health (NYSE:ARDT) Reaches New 1-Year Low on Analyst Downgrade

Ardent Health, Inc. (NYSE:ARDTGet Free Report)’s stock price reached a new 52-week low during mid-day trading on Tuesday after JPMorgan Chase & Co. lowered their price target on the stock from $12.00 to $11.00. JPMorgan Chase & Co. currently has a neutral rating on the stock. Ardent Health traded as low as $8.26 and last traded at $8.2550, with a volume of 220293 shares traded. The stock had previously closed at $8.60.

Several other equities analysts have also recently commented on the company. KeyCorp cut Ardent Health from an “overweight” rating to a “sector weight” rating in a report on Monday, November 17th. Bank of America cut their target price on Ardent Health from $12.00 to $10.00 and set an “underperform” rating for the company in a research note on Thursday, November 13th. Leerink Partners set a $16.00 price target on shares of Ardent Health in a research note on Friday, November 14th. Weiss Ratings reissued a “sell (d)” rating on shares of Ardent Health in a report on Monday, December 29th. Finally, Truist Financial dropped their price objective on shares of Ardent Health from $21.00 to $13.00 and set a “buy” rating for the company in a research note on Friday, November 14th. Six investment anal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ating, four have assigned a Hold rating and two have assigned a Sell rating to the stock. Based on data from MarketBeat.com, the stock has a consensus rating of “Hold” and an average price target of $14.58.

Key Ardent Health News

Here are the key news stories impacting Ardent Health this week:

  • Positive Sentiment: Contrarian/bull case published outlining reasons to buy ARDT amid the selloff; may attract value investors looking past near‑term litigation risk. A Bull Case Theory
  • Negative Sentiment: Multiple national plaintiff law firms have filed or issued investor alerts about a securities class action alleging accounting/revenue recognition and reserve misstatements tied to Ardent’s Q3 2025 results; firms are soliciting lead‑plaintiff applicants with a March 9, 2026 deadline — this increases the risk of litigation expense, management distraction, and prolonged share‑price pressure. Ardent Health Stock Up 2.4%

The company has a current ratio of 2.08, a quick ratio of 1.95 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.67. The company has a market capitalization of $1.22 billion, a P/E ratio of 5.86, a PEG ratio of 4.81 and a beta of 0.72. The firm’s 50 day moving average price is $8.85 and its two-hundred day moving average price is $11.63.

Ardent Health (NYSE:ARDTG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Wednesday, November 12th. The company reported $0.52 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.42 by $0.10. Ardent Health had a net margin of 3.24% and a return on equity of 19.02%. The business had revenue of $1.58 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.55 billion. Ardent Health has set its FY 2025 guidance at 0.850-1.030 EPS. Equities research analysts forecast that Ardent Health, Inc. will post 1.23 EPS for the current year.

Ardent Health, listed on the New York Stock Exchange under the ticker ARDT, is a healthcare delivery company focused on acquiring, developing and managing acute care hospitals and complementary outpatient facilities across the United States. The company’s integrated platform encompasses both inpatient and outpatient services, designed to provide end-to-end care solutions and address the full continuum of patient needs.

Through its network, Ardent Health operates general hospitals, emergency departments, ambulatory surgery centers, urgent care clinics, rehabilitation and post-acute care facilities.
